Pleasantview

Part of the Greater Edmonton metropolitan area, Pleasantview is a neighbourhood within Edmonton, Alberta.

Transportation

Pleasantview allows homeowners to travel using several methods of transportation. The reasonably good transit system makes transit a viable option for many people. For example, house owners benefit from Southgate Station on the Capital Line. The neighbourhood is connected by approximately 20 bus lines, and the nearest bus stop is generally very close by. A majority of the homes for sale in this area are located in places that are also reasonably conducive to those who get around on foot; running daily errands is convenient without a vehicle, and a good number of businesses of different types can be found as well. Pleasantview is a fairly convenient part of Edmonton for cyclists. More specifically, the cycling infrastructure is good, and there are a limited number of elevation changes for cyclists to brave.

Services

The nearest grocery store in Pleasantview is usually only a rather short stroll away. Additionally, there are a good number of opportunities for those who value nearby restaurants and cafes. It is also a short stroll to a very good choice of clothing stores. When it comes to education, families will welcome that wherever their home is situated in Pleasantview, schools and daycares are close by.

Character

Pleasantview has a character that appeals to a fairly diverse group of people. Even though the ambience is not the liveliest in this neighbourhood with the nightlife venues in nearby neighbourhoods, it is easy to find a place to grab a drink because they are generally located close by. Pleasantview is very quiet, as the streets are usually very peaceful. It is very easy to reach green spaces in the neighbourhood since there are about 30 of them close by for residents to unwind in.

Housing

In Pleasantview, roughly 45% of buildings are single detached homes, but large apartment buildings and small apartment buildings are also present in the housing stock. A majority of the housing growth in this area took place in the 1960s and 1970s. This part of the city is primarily composed of two bedroom and four or more bedroom homes. The population residing in this neighbourhood is evenly split between owners and renters.
